How long does a divorce take in New York?
The duration of a divorce in New York varies depending on the complexity of the case and the level of cooperation between parties. On average, an uncontested divorce can take several months, while a contested divorce can take a year or more. What is the difference between a contested and uncontested divorce?
A contested divorce occurs when spouses cannot agree on key issues, such as property division or child custody. An uncontested divorce, on the other hand, involves a mutual agreement on all terms.
